The Chicago Blackhawks signed Pascal Pelletier to a one-year contract Friday. The 25-year-old center came to the Blackhawks from the Boston Bruins in a July 24 trade for center Martin St. Pierre. Pelletier played in six games last season with Boston. He scored 71 goals in 206 regular-season games with Providence of the AHL between 2005-08.

Pascal Pelletier was never drafted by an NHL team. The NHL was in lockdown when he turned pro in 2004-05, a season in which he played for Louisiana and Gwinnett of the East Coast Hockey League. He signed as a free agent with the Bruins July 28, 2006, but had never been called up to the big club.

The Boston Bruins recalled American Hockey League goal-scoring leader Pascal Pelletier from Providence on Wednesday. Pelletier, who leads the AHL with 24 goals, also has 24 assists in 40 games for Providence this season. He was signed by Boston as a free agent in 2006.
